(Published in “The Nashville Tennessean,” 26/27 Jun 1959)
Kallock—Thursday morning, June 25, 1959, at 1 o’clock, at a local infirmary, Miss Carrie Kallock. Survived by sister, Mrs. Kathleen K. Manning; brother Edward R. Kallock: nephew, Robert L. Manning Jr. Remains are at Martin’s, 209 Louise Ave. Funeral Saturday, morning June 27, 1959, leaving at 9 o’clock. Requiem High Mass from the Church of Christ The King, at 9:30 o’clock. Interment Calvary Cemetery. The rosary will be recited Friday evening at 8 o’clock. Martin’s, 209 Louise Ave. H. Zeb Brevard, Roy Prince, Madden Teeple, William L. Cook, George M. Smith, Russell Nichol will serve as pallbearers.
